Cohabitation duration (grouped) (v513)

Data file: REC51

Overview

Type: Discrete
Decimal: 0
Start: 37
End: 37
Width: 1
Range: 0 - 7
Format: Numeric

Questions and instructions

Question pretext
Ever-married women (V501 <> 0).
Categories
Value Category
0 Never married
1 0-4
2 5-9
3 10-14
4 15-19
5 20-24
6 25-29
7 30+
Warning: these figures indicate the number of cases found in the data file. They cannot be interpreted as summary statistics of the population of interest.

Others

Notes
Marital duration is actually the number of years elapsed since the start of the first marriage or union until the date of interview grouped into five-year groups, irrespective of whether the respondent is still married to her first partner.
